๐Ÿ”„ Offline-First Strategy

Write Operations

  1. Save to local Isar immediately
  2. Show success to user
  3. Add to sync queue
  4. Background sync when online
  5. Update with server response

Read Operations

  1. Read from local Isar (fast)
  2. Show to user immediately
  3. Background fetch from API
  4. Update local cache if changed
  5. Notify UI if data updated

Conflict Resolution

  • Strategy: Last-write-wins
  • Timestamp: Server timestamp as source of truth
  • Logging: All conflicts logged for audit
